Westbound I-40 In Durham County Reduced To One Lane This Weekend

RALEIGH, N.C. — The N.C. Department of Transportation reported that it would reduce traffic this weekend to one lane on westbound I-40 in Durham County between N.C. 751 and N.C. 54.

Officials said the lane reduction would begin on Friday, June 10 at 8 p.m. and end at 6 a.m. on Monday, June 13.

The lane closures are necessary to complete the I-40 widening project, officials said.

They recommend motorists take N.C. 147 to I-85 South back to I-40 as an alternate route.
